The baby name Bericha is a Female name , 3 syllables long and is pronounced beh-REE-kah (Anglicized); Hebrew: beh-REE-khah (guttural 'ch') — IPA: /bəˈriːkə/ or /bəˈriːχə/.
Bericha is Hebrew in Origin.

Bericha is a rare feminine given name of Semitic origin, related to Hebrew berakhah (ברכה) meaning "blessing" and Aramaic berikha/brikha meaning "blessed," with the broader cognate Arabic baraka. The spelling with ch reflects the guttural kh sound; variants often render it as Bracha or Beracha. As such, Bericha carries the auspicious sense of divine favor or a prayerful blessing.
In Jewish naming, forms of this root have long been used: Ashkenazi Yiddish Brokhe/Brocha, Sephardi/Ladino Beracha, and modern Israeli Bracha; rarer transliterations include Berikha and Bericha. Diminutives Brachi/Brochi appear in contemporary Hebrew and English usage. Related or masculine counterparts include Baruch and the biblical Berechiah/Berakhiah ("Yah has blessed"). Though spelled similarly to Bricha, the post-WWII underground that aided Jewish refugees, that term derives from "flight" (bericha, בריחה) and is etymologically distinct.
